DSHS horses perform well at international competitions

22 July 2020

Right after the corona-break, multiple horses that have been sold at the Dutch Sport Horse Sales in the past, have performed well. In Opglabbeek and Kronenberg, various DSHS references ensured good advertising. For example, Kamara van ‘t Heike and Eric van der Vleuten booked a 1.45m Grand Prix victory at CSI De Peelbergen and other references claimed prizes at Sentower Park.

In the 1.40m class at CSI2* Opglabbeek, Pal Flam jumped to the fifth prize with the clear jumping Elisabeth (Applaus x Colman, DSHS 2015). The Manton Grange rider Shane O’Meara was successful at the same show in Belgium with several DSHS horses. For example, he jumped double clear with Haranta (Zirocco Blue VDL x Carolus II, DSHS 2017) and ended up fourth in the 1* Grand Prix (1.35m ) on Saturday. Joy Lammers was fourth in the Youngster Tour in Opglabbeek with the double clear jumping Ibeau SMH (Quasimodo Z x Tygo, DSHS 2017). At the Warm Up CSI at De Peelbergen Eric van der Vleuten grabbed the victory in the 1.45m Grand Prix with the ten-year-old Kamara van ‘t Heike (Epleaser van’ t Heike x Carthago), who was part of the 2015 collection. They showed unbeatable in the jump-off.
